Description
In this delicate view of the French suburban town Charenton-le-Pont, on the right bank of the Seine, tiny boats, suggested by a few pen and ink lines, glide under a bridge. The striking, reflective surface of the water is suggested by the bright white of the paper. Pennell executed a number of panoramic views of Paris in 1893. The linear quality of this drawing suggests that this may have been a preliminary study for an etching which was never executed.- Nature Sublime: Landscapes from the 19th Century.
